Kosten Koper - Buyer’s costs
Buyer’s costs means that additional purchase costs are paid by the buyer.
Kosten Koper, often abbreviated as k.k., means that the buyer pays additional costs such as transfer tax, notary costs and other purchase-related expenses. These costs are usually not fully financed by the mortgage and should be included in the buyer’s own funds.
